Filmmaker and choreographer Farah Khan has sparked controversy with her latest remark about the festival of Holi. Currently seen in Celebrity MasterChef, Farah made a statement that upset many people.
Trolled by people
During a recent conversation, Farah Khan referred to Holi as a festival celebrated by ‘chhapri’ people. She said, “Saare chhapri logon ka favourite festival Holi hota hai.” This comment did not go well with many social media users, who felt that she had insulted the festival and its significance.
People took to social media to express their anger. One user wrote, “Do you ever talk about any of your festivals? Disgusting.” Another commented, “What the heck does she mean… Aur chhapri… ha ha ha, look who’s talking.” Many others also criticised Farah, calling her statement insensitive and disrespectful.
